Whale Dream Meaning

Dreaming of a whale typically symbolizes deep emotions, intuition, wisdom, and the vastness of the subconscious mind.

Encountering a whale in your dreams often points to profound aspects of your inner world and your connection to something much larger than yourself. Whales are ancient, immense creatures that inhabit the deepest parts of the ocean, making them powerful symbols of the subconscious mind, intuition, and hidden wisdom. Their sheer size can represent overwhelming feelings or experiences, but also the deep reserves of knowledge and understanding that lie within you. Dreaming of a whale may surface when you are tapping into your intuition, facing significant emotional depths, or seeking a deeper understanding of life's mysteries. These dreams can be a call to explore the hidden parts of your psyche, to trust your gut feelings, or to acknowledge the vast potential and wisdom you possess.

Consider the context of the whale’s appearance. Was the whale breaching majestically out of the water, or was it swimming serenely in the deep? A breaching whale can symbolize a sudden realization, a breakthrough in understanding, or the emergence of powerful emotions or creative energy. It might represent something from your subconscious rising to the surface, demanding your attention. If the whale was swimming in deep, dark waters, it might reflect the unknown aspects of your subconscious, or perhaps a situation where you feel you are navigating through deep emotional waters with little visibility. Were you interacting with the whale, perhaps swimming alongside it or even being swallowed by it? Swimming with a whale could suggest harmony with your intuition or a deep connection to universal wisdom. Being swallowed might symbolize being overwhelmed by emotions, a situation, or the subconscious itself, but it can also represent a profound transformation or rebirth, akin to Jonah and the whale.

The emotional tone and setting of the dream are crucial for interpretation. How did you feel upon seeing the whale? Were you filled with awe and wonder, or did you feel fear and trepidation? A sense of awe often accompanies dreams of whales, suggesting a reverence for the subconscious, intuition, or the mysteries of life. Fear might indicate resistance to exploring your deeper emotions or confronting aspects of yourself that feel too large to handle. The environment where you encountered the whale also provides clues. Was it in a vast, open ocean, suggesting boundless potential and the unknown, or perhaps in a more confined space, like a bay or even a swimming pool, which might indicate that these deep emotions or intuitions are feeling restricted or contained in your waking life?

In your waking life, a dream featuring a whale may be prompting you to pay closer attention to your intuition and subconscious guidance. It could be a sign that you need to delve deeper into your feelings or a complex situation, trusting that you have the inner wisdom to navigate it. The dream might also be reflecting a sense of feeling small or insignificant in the face of larger life challenges or responsibilities, but the whale's presence ultimately suggests you have the strength and depth to handle them. It can be an invitation to connect with your inner self on a profound level, to listen to the quiet whispers of your intuition, and to recognize the vast, untapped potential that resides within you.

Upon waking from a whale dream, consider what areas of your life might require deeper introspection or a more intuitive approach. Ask yourself if you've been ignoring your gut feelings or avoiding exploring complex emotional territory. Perhaps you can set aside time for quiet reflection, meditation, or journaling to connect with your inner wisdom. If the dream felt overwhelming, focus on the aspects of intuition and wisdom the whale represents, reminding yourself of your inherent capacity to understand and navigate your experiences. The whale dream often serves as a gentle reminder of the profound depths within, urging you to explore them with respect and curiosity.
